IP查询
查询
你查询的IP:[59.32.11.125] 地理位置:中国–广东–河源
最新查询
124.29.4.224
121.8.70.133
121.16.21.108
123.184.22.87
116.252.51.74
116.56.220.24
59.155.135.182
122.204.151.150
121.56.111.191
59.32.11.125
125.216.37.176
118.239.73.122
116.248.137.193
120.30.93.175
222.192.65.223
124.68.107.208
202.41.240.155
116.89.144.219
116.13.113.99
118.244.64.84
118.224.1.80
118.88.128.200
203.100.96.66
202.8.128.65
58.68.128.209
116.213.64.247
203.175.128.15
117.32.124.152
120.76.68.163
203.142.219.104
123.232.224.191